What makes are people installing? I install haverland ultrarad atm but finding the heater almost impossible to control for users that dont own te property ie holiday lets. Look forward to replies
 
I don't fit them... but from my research a while ago... all electric panel heaters have big issues with the methods of control. That's why I'm trying to engineer my own solution that allows individual centralised room control. With electricity being 3x the price of gas, one of the few ways they can compete has to be with very precise control.

It'll be interesting to see what others have to say about them.
